What are Baby’s 1st Birthday Favor Ideas?

Baby’s 1st birthday favor ideas are small gifts or goodies that are given to guests at a baby’s 1st birthday party. These favors can be anything from toys, books, snacks, or keepsakes that commemorate the special occasion.

Top 10 Tips and Ideas on Baby’s 1st Birthday Favor Ideas

Here are the top 10 tips and ideas for baby’s 1st birthday favors:

  1. Personalized onesies or t-shirts with the baby’s name or picture.
  2. Baby or toddler books with a special message or note.
  3. Customized cookies or cupcakes with the baby’s name or picture.
  4. Stuffed animals or plush toys.
  5. Baby-safe bath toys or bubble bath.
  6. DIY sensory bottles or playdough kits.
  7. Baby-safe musical instruments or noise makers.
  8. Baby food or snack pouches.
  9. Sustainable or eco-friendly toys such as wooden blocks or bamboo utensils.
  10. Personalized photo frames or keepsakes.

FAQs:

Q: How many favors should I order for a baby’s 1st birthday party?

A: The number of favors to order depends on the size of the party and the budget. As a general rule, it’s best to order a few extra favors to account for any unexpected guests or last-minute additions.

Q: What are some budget-friendly baby’s 1st birthday favor ideas?

A: Some budget-friendly baby’s 1st birthday favor ideas include DIY sensory bottles, homemade playdough kits, baby food pouches, or baby-safe bath toys.

Q: Can I have different favors for different age groups of children?

A: Yes, you can customize the favors based on the age group of the children attending the party. For example, you can have different favors for babies, toddlers, and older children.
